POSITION SUMMARY:  


  
As our Development and Communications (DevCom) Assistant, you will aid and support our DevCom Department in regular ongoing projects, as well as ad-hoc and one-off projects. This position requires excellent organizational and communication skills, the ability to manage multiple short- and long-term objectives, foster an agency-wide culture of community, and maintain a calm, pleasant, and professional demeanor. The DevCom Assistant will perform a broad range of tasks and will develop unique working relationships across teams at Quest.   


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:  
 


  • Perform data entry for donation admin and maintain current and accurate donation records, including CRM maintenance, 

  • Assist with creation, posting, and scheduling of Social Media postings, newsletters, website updates, and event communications,  

  • Assist with set up and organization of Podcasts, press coverage, and events,  

  • Collaborate with Merch and Brand design, including ordering, inventory, and distribution of orders,  

  • As a member of our Events Committee, you will play a vital role in the brainstorming, organizing, and creation of Events and Fundraising efforts,  

  • Collaborate with the DevCom Department and internally to boost staff and client buy in and participation in DevCom activities, 

  • Solicit, develop, grow, and maintain, partnerships and donor relations, including in-kind donations, sponsorships, and other DevCom partnerships,
